Henry Tse has been appointed as Group General Manager - Hotel Operations & Brand Development at Hotel COZi, Bay Bridge Lifestyle Retreat and Commune

Mr. Henry Tse, current General Manager of Hotel COZi, is now appointed as the Group General Manager - Hotel Operations & Brand Development of Hotel COZi, Bay Bridge Lifestyle Retreat and Commune (managing 5 hotels and a co-living space, 2,382 guestrooms in total). Henry's commitment to Tang's Living Group extends back to 2017, when he first joined Hotel COZi as Hotel Manager and was part of the hotel's pre-opening management team. Prior to joining Tang's Living Group, Henry had gained over 30 years of experience in the hospitality industry and served various management positions at hotels such as Dorsett Tsuen Wan Hong Kong and Silka Far East Hotel. With his extensive experience and in-depth insight, he helped steer the team to a successful opening and led Hotel COZi to greater heights in terms of hotel performance, service standards and positive brand reputation.

Michael J Donlevy has been appointed as Culinary Director at The Langham, Hong Kong

The Langham, Hong Kong appoints Michael J Donlevy as Culinary Director and Ng Tzer Tzun in his right-hand position as Executive Sous Chef. Together, they will lead the hotel's culinary brigade in overseeing dining operations at the 498-room luxury hotel with six restaurants and bars, private dining for guests in residence, The Langham Club Lounge, as well as catering for various creative events.

Steven Lee has been promoted to APAC Managing Director at HRS Hospitality and Retail Systems

HRS Hospitality and Retail Systems, Oracle Hospitality's largest global Platinum Partner, has announced the promotion of Steven Lee to the position of Managing Director, HRS Asia Pacific. Steven will lead HRS in this region with the remit to develop, maintain, and expand our product and service portfolio, especially in China.

Veronica Chan has been appointed as Director of Human Resources at InterContinental Hong Kong

Veronica Chang, who recently joined InterContinental Hong Kong as Director of Human Resources, brings to her new position over 15 years of work experience with international conglomerates, including Carrier Hong Kong Limited where she most recently served as Human Resource Director for Hong Kong, Macau, Taiwan and Guam, overseeing the full spectrum of HR functions across the region.
